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a vacuum cleaner visually and acoustically confirming the suction state of filth during the use, improving the satisfaction and attainment of cleaning, improving the usability and allowing a user to feel fun in the cleaning work. <P>SOLUTION: This vacuum cleaner is provided with an air suction port 16, a first dust collection chamber 15 temporarily storing the filth sucked from the suction port 16, allowing the user to confirm it from the outside, and having a separation means separating the air from the filth, a second dust collection chamber 5 communicated with the downstream side of the first duct collection chamber 15, allowing the air to pass through and be exhausted and having a storage means storing the filth, and a moving means 21 positioned in the side of the first dust collection chamber 15 and selectively moving the filth in the first dust collection chamber 15 to the side of the second dust collection chamber 5.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2004,JPO&NCIPI

[0001]
TECHNICAL FIELD O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to a vacuum cleaner capable of selectively moving dust from one dust collection chamber to another dust collection chamber, and more specifically, a first vacuum cleaner capable of externally checking dust sucked during use. The present invention relates to a vacuum cleaner capable of temporarily storing dust in a dust collection chamber and selectively moving the dust to a second dust collection chamber.
[0002]
[Prior art]
Conventional vacuum cleaners use a filter type that uses cloth or nonwoven fabric as a means to separate air and dust, or a paper pack that makes a filter into a bag and stores the dust in the bag, and throws away the dust together with the bag. There were formulas and cyclone formulas that did not use filters.
[0003]
For example, a flow guiding means is provided for the purpose of improving the cyclone performance, and all the separated dust is injected into a dust collection box partitioned in a tangential direction of the cyclone chamber by centrifugal force, and the air in the dust collection chamber is relatively dynamic. There has been a vacuum cleaner having a configuration in which movement is small (for example, see Patent Document 1).
[0004]
[Patent Document 1]
Japanese Patent No. 3145086 (pages 3-4, FIGS. 6-8)
[0005]
[Problems to be solved by the invention]
However, the technique of separating dust using a cyclone according to Patent Literature 1 has conflicting problems such as a small dust collection capacity because there is no compression effect of the dust, and an increase in the capacity reduces the usability as a vacuum cleaner. .

Next, an operation in a state where the cyclone outlet 18 during operation is closed by the filter unit 21 will be described. In FIG. 1, when the cleaner body 1 is operated, air and dust pass through accessories (not shown) such as brushes, pipes, and hoses, and are sucked through the suction port 16. The dust is sucked into the first dust collection chamber 15 while rotating along the inner wall surface through the cyclone inlet 17, and the coarse dust such as cotton dust having a large specific gravity is removed by the cyclone dust separation function. The fine dust keeps turning on the inner wall surface of the chamber 15 and is collected by the coarse dust filter 26 and the fine dust filter 27.
[0015]
The air thus filtered flows into the second dust collection chamber 5, passes through the paper filter 7, and is exhausted to the outside of the cleaner body 1. Even if the operation is restarted after the operation is stopped, the coarse dust in the first dust collection chamber 15 continues to rotate again. At the same time, the first dust collection chamber 15 is made of a transparent material, and the degree of rotation of the sucked dust changes according to the amount of dust. Can be. Further, when there is no dust on the floor, there is no rotation of the dust at the cyclone entrance 17 and only the air rotates. Therefore, the removal of dust on the floor can be determined from the transparency check of the amount of passing dust. This secondarily leads to a feeling of satisfaction and satisfaction of the cleaning, and the cleaning can be performed happily.
[0016]
Next, the operation in a state where the slide shaft 28 is moved upward and the cyclone outlet 18 is opened by the filter unit 21 during operation will be described. In FIG. 4, when the cleaner body 1 is operated, air and dust pass through accessories such as a floor brush, a pipe, and a hose and are absorbed through the suction port 16. The dust is sucked into the first dust collection chamber 15 while rotating along the inner wall surface through the cyclone inlet 17, and coarse dust such as cotton dust having a large specific gravity is removed by the cyclone dust separation function. 15, the fine dust passes through the cyclone outlet 18, is collected by the paper filter 7 of the second dust collection chamber 5, and the filtered air is exhausted outside the cleaner body 1.
[0017]
When the operation of the vacuum cleaner main body 1 is stopped, coarse dust slides down by the funnel surface 19 of the first dust collecting chamber 15 and approaches the cyclone outlet 18, and since no rotational force is applied at the time of starting at the time of re-operation, The coarse dust in the first dust collection chamber 15 is sucked into the second dust collection chamber 5 and collected by the paper filter 7, and the filtered air is exhausted out of the main body. At this time, the degree of rotation of the sucked dust changes according to the amount of dust. However, since the first dust collection chamber 15 is made of a transparent material, the user can visually check the amount of dust and confirm the discard of dust by its movement. can do.
[0018]
Further, when there is no dust on the floor, the dust is not rotated at the cyclone entrance 17 and only the air is rotated. Therefore, the removal of dust on the floor can be determined by checking the transparency of the amount of passing dust. If the dust in the first dust collection chamber 15 has a storage capacity or more, that is, a storage capacity or more, and more dust is sucked, the dust is automatically sucked into the second dust collection chamber 5 side. This secondarily leads to a feeling of accomplishment and satisfaction of the cleaning, and the cleaning can be performed happily.
[0019]
Next, disposal of dust in the first dust collection chamber 15 will be described. The first dust collecting chamber 15 is detached from the cleaner main body 1 by operating the attachment / detachment latch 20 of the first dust collecting chamber 15, and as shown in FIG. Operate to open the cyclone outlet 18. In this manner, the dust is slid down by the funnel surface 19 and discharged from the cyclone outlet 18. When vibration is applied to the first dust collection chamber 15, powdery dust slides down from the cyclone outlet 18 by the funnel surface 19 and is discharged. Since the first dust collecting chamber 15 is made of a transparent material, it is possible to check the remaining undischarged dust.
